he Hidden Contaminants on Fruits and Vegetables
Even the most attractive fruits and vegetables available in the market may not be as clean as they appear. From farm to fork, they pass through multiple hands, surfaces, and storage environments—exposing them to:
-
Pesticides and chemical fertilizers
-
Waxes used for prolonged shelf life
-
Soil and dirt particles
-
Pathogens such as E. coli, Salmonella, and Listeria
-
Residues from handling and transportation
Rinsing with plain water alone is not effective in removing these contaminants. That’s where a fruit washing liquid or fruit cleaner plays a crucial role.
What Is a Fruit Washing Liquid?
A fruit washing liquid is a specially formulated, food-safe solution made to clean fresh produce. It helps eliminate dirt, wax, pesticide residues, and bacteria from the surface of fruits and vegetables. Most high-quality versions are made using natural ingredients like citrus extracts, vinegar, baking soda, or bio-based surfactants—making them safe for everyday use.

How to Use a Fruit Washing Liquid Correctly
-
Mix the recommended amount of fruit washing liquid with water in a clean bowl.
-
Soak the fruits or vegetables for a 1 minutes.
-
Gently rub using your hands or a soft brush (if required).
-
Rinse thoroughly with clean water before consumption.
This simple routine can drastically reduce harmful residues and improve your family’s overall health.
